Hulk_77 wrote: » Fixing War is simple and does not need to be a complex overhaul. I will lay it out real quick: 1) Make 2 portals able to hit the leftmost mini-boss (currently only 1 does) 2) Keep diversity internal to battle groups. Its current state is apparently a bug, but it also makes the most sense. I does not grant advantage to alliances who have champs like a Deadpool or Kang, and each attacker is only fighting in one battle group anyways. Spreading it across the whole alliance is an incredible headache to manage as well. Plus, with less than 150 champs (107 currently I think), this would reward having 50 different defenders in each battle group vs having 100 unique defenders jammed into 2 BGs with the third BG filled with nothing but Magik, Dorm, Nightcrawler, etc. Which is where the meta will trend, and it will be complete unfair for whichever BG ends up drawing that opponent's BG. 3) Change scoring to the below: Points Breakdown: Node Exploration: 300 per Node (equals out to before, when it was 450) Boss Kill: 20 000 Points Defenders Placed: 50 per Defender Placed Defender Diversity: 125 per Unique Defender Defender Rating: 0.002 per PI Attacker Kills: 150 per Kill (please note this only works with diversity INTERNAL to BGs, not alliance wide) Defender Kills: 50 per Kill This points breakdown actually leaves a skill element (not dying) and makes diversity matter. And as for not attacking because you're afraid you'd die... clearing the node in less than 9 deaths is still a net point gain for the attacker, so it shouldn't be a big deal. Without defender kills, the skill element is completely gone, and war's outcomes are determined before the first punch is thrown. Which simply put, just isn't any fun. This is a game, right? The above setup challenges an alliance to make the best possible defense it can while also using 50 diverse champs in each battle group, which is great for variety and will make war less boring. It also keeps skill a factor. If you can clear the map in less deaths than your opponent, you can beat an opponent that is more highly ranked than you. Which is how war should be.
